site stats

Ttf cmap table

WebDefined in FT_TRUETYPE_IDS_H (freetype/ttnameid.h). Possible values of the language identifier field in the name records of the SFNT ‘name’ table if the ‘platform’ identifier code is TT_PLATFORM_MICROSOFT. These values are also used as return values for function FT_Get_CMap_Language_ID. Webmerging partial .ttx files with existing .ttf or .otf files. listing brief table info instead of dumping to .ttx. ... The glyph names are either extracted from the CFF table or the post table, or are derived from a Unicode cmap table. In the latter case the Adobe Glyph List is used to calculate names based on Unicode values.

How do I inspect the cmap table and subtables in a TrueType font?

WebTrueType fonts (TTF) ... Each table is a sequence of words and has a name known as Tag. Each tag is of uint32 data type and consists of four characters. The first table in the file is … WebJun 24, 2024 · R14 version, generating pdf custom font error, but PDF font displayed correctly java.io.IOException: The TrueType font does not contain a 'cmap' table at org.apache.fontbox.ttf.TrueTypeFont.getUnicodeCmap(TrueTypeFont.java:477) at org.ap... chorizo with scrambled egg https://jocatling.com

ttx — fontTools Documentation - Read the Docs

WebinitSubtable (CmapTable cmap, int numGlyphs, org.apache.fontbox.ttf.TTFDataStream data) This will read the required data from the stream. protected void ... processSubtype8 … WebDec 8, 2024 · OpenType font files should use the extension .OTF, .TTF, .OTC or .TTC. (The extension may be upper or lower case.) ... Font2’s 'cmap' table points to the Kana2 region of the 'loca' and 'glyf' tables for kana glyphs, and to the same kanji region for the kanji. WebMar 10, 2008 · The italic angle of Arial Bold Italic is 12º while Garava Italic has an italic angle of 6º. Wordpad is using a one-size-fits-all value of about 15º. The actual angle of the glyphs in fonts may not match the italic angle. Look at Brush Script, for example. It is a regular font, not italic. Italic Angle.png. chorjugend petersaurach

OpenType font file (OpenType 1.9) - Typography Microsoft Learn

Category:TrueType Tables - FreeType-2.13.0 API Reference

Tags:Ttf cmap table

Ttf cmap table

Fonts - TrueType Reference Manual - Apple Developer

WebA TrueType font file consists of a sequence of concatenated tables. A table is a sequence of words. Each table must be long aligned and padded with zeroes if necessary. The first of … This table defines the mapping of character codes to the glyph index values used in the font. It may contain more than one subtable, in order to support more than one character encoding scheme. See more The Character To Glyph Index Mapping Table is organized as follows: See more The language field must be set to zero for all 'cmap' subtables whose platform IDs are other than Macintosh (platform ID 1). For 'cmap' subtables whose platform IDs are Macintosh, set this field to the Macintosh language … See more

Ttf cmap table

Did you know?

WebThe 'name' table General table information. The name table (tag: 'name') allows you to include human-readable names for features and settings, copyright notices, font names, style names, and other information related to your font.These name character strings containing font-related information can be provided in any language. Entries in the name … WebFont::TTF::Cmap - Character map table. DESCRIPTION. Looks after the character map. For ease of use, the actual cmap is held in a hash against codepoint. ... Tidies the cmap table. …

Web# This only happens if the cmap table is loaded before any # other table that does f.getGlyphOrder() or f.getGlyphName(). cmapLoading = self. tables ["cmap"] del self. tables ["cmap"] else: cmapLoading = None # Make up glyph names based on glyphID, which will be used by the # temporary cmap and by the real cmap in case we don't find a unicode ...

WebMay 23, 2003 · The ‘cmap’ table consists of a set of mapping subtables for different technologies and architectures. This allows the same font to work on multiple operating … WebNov 1, 2024 · Even though TTF files are binary ones and are not meant to be read by humans directly, they are not magic either. ... So to introduce it a bit, cmap table is based on segments. Segments are contiguous ranges of character codes to allow the font to define only a subset of Unicode characters.

WebAug 12, 2024 · So, while cmap table is required for TrueType fonts it can be excluded from the subset being embedded in the process of creating the PDF. Also important to point …

WebThe following table gives an example of the parameters required to map characters 10-20, 30-90, and 100-153 to a contiguous range of glyph indices. The parameter segCount = 4 … chorizo y salchichon ibericoWebDec 8, 2024 · OpenType font files should use the extension .OTF, .TTF, .OTC or .TTC. (The extension may be upper or lower case.) ... Font2’s 'cmap' table points to the Kana2 region … chor joy gochsheimWebTrueType fonts (TTF) ... Each table is a sequence of words and has a name known as Tag. Each tag is of uint32 data type and consists of four characters. The first table in the file is font directory that gives access to other tables in the font file. ... Table ‘cmap ’ character to ... chorkantatenWebJun 15, 2024 · These can be used for any platform that supports this language-tag mechanism. A font using a version 1 naming table may use a combination of platform … chor kam hung facebookWebDec 8, 2024 · However, some host OpenType/TTF fonts also contain a 'post' table, format 4, which provides a mapping from glyph ID to encoding value, and also corresponds to a particular Macintosh 'cmap' subtable. Unfortunately, the 'post' table format 4 contains no provision for identifying which Macintosh 'cmap' subtable it matches, nor for providing … chorizo wurst bratenWebFreeBSD Manual Pages man apropos apropos chorka fashionWebBest Java code snippets using org.apache.fontbox.ttf.CmapSubtable (Showing top 20 results out of 315) chor karnchang